What is PerchPeek?
Founded in 2017 and headquartered in London, PerchPeek operates as an AI-powered home search assistant designed to simplify the relocation journey. The platform functions as a comprehensive digital concierge, utilizing machine learning algorithms to match individuals with suitable housing while providing logistical support throughout the transition. By integrating search, discovery, and settling-in services, PerchPeek effectively bridges the gap between traditional real estate brokerage and modern, tech-enabled property management. Its market position is defined by its ability to reduce the administrative burden of moving, catering to both individual flat-hunters and corporate clients seeking efficient relocation solutions.
How much funding has PerchPeek raised?
PerchPeek has raised a total of $13.5M across 2 funding rounds:

Other Financing Round (2021): $2.7M with participation from Episode 1 Ventures LLP
Series A (2022): $10.8M led by Stage 2 Capital and Albion Capital Group
Key Investors in PerchPeek
Episode 1 Ventures LLP
A London-based venture capital firm specializing in early-stage software businesses with high growth potential, typically acting as the first institutional investor.
Stage 2 Capital
A venture capital fund backed by over 800 go-to-market experts that provides operational expertise and data-driven frameworks to help B2B software companies scale revenue.
Albion Capital Group
A prominent investment firm focused on supporting high-growth companies through long-term capital partnerships and strategic guidance.
